    net/mlx5: Fix FTE cleanup · cefc2355
    Maor Gottlieb authored
    Currently, when an FTE is allocated, its refcount is decreased to 0
    with the purpose it will not be a stand alone steering object and every
    rule (destination) of the FTE would increase the refcount.
    When mlx5_cleanup_fs is called while not all rules were deleted by the
    steering users, it hit refcount underflow on the FTE once clean_tree
    calls to tree_remove_node after the deleted rules already decreased
    the refcount to 0.
    
    FTE is no longer destroyed implicitly when the last rule (destination)
    is deleted. mlx5_del_flow_rules avoids it by increasing the refcount on
    the FTE and destroy it explicitly after all rules were deleted. So we
    can avoid the refcount underflow by making FTE as stand alone object.
    In addition need to set del_hw_func to FTE so the HW object will be
    destroyed when the FTE is deleted from the cleanup_tree flow.
